The station is equipped to cater to various passenger needs with its different facilities and services. The ticket office at New Brighton operates with extensive opening hours, from 5:38 am to 12:28 am on weekdays and 7:38 am to 12:28 am on Sundays. For those who prefer modern conveniences, tickets can be collected from the ticket office, even if purchased online, with accessible ticket machines available for all passengers. Smartcards are a practical option at this station, where both issuance and validation are supported.
Passengers can feel secure with the presence of CCTV monitoring across the station. While there are no luggage storage options, the station compensates with friendly staff help available during operating hours and customer help points. Although New Brighton lacks ticket barriers, the station accommodates all with its Category A step-free access, ensuring smooth navigation to the platforms and ticket office.
Hungry travelers will appreciate the presence of a café and vending machines for both cold drinks and snacks, but note that there are no cash machines or shops on-site. For those ready to pedal their way through the area, bicycle storage is available with sheltered and CCTV-secured stands. Unfortunately, there are no cycle hire facilities, but you can easily use your bicycle once at your destination.
New Brighton's connectivity is further complemented by its integration with other transport modes. Although no taxi rank exists directly at the station, onward travel is facilitated by local bus services. The nearest airport, Liverpool John Lennon Airport, can be conveniently reached by purchasing a combined rail/bus ticket at any Merseyrail station. This will allow you to catch buses 86A or 80A from Liverpool South Parkway, taking just ten minutes to reach the airport.

Wishaw Train Station offers a variety of facilities designed to enhance your travel experience. With a ticket office open Monday to Saturday from 06:20 to 20:04, and ticket machines accessible even outside these hours, obtaining your travel pass is convenient and straightforward. The station is equ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ops to cater to all travelers' needs.
Although the station might lack a few conveniences such as shops or refreshment options, the focus on efficient rail service makes it a prime access point. The station is steeped in care with available customer support at help points and from the informative staff at the ticket office. Have questions or missing belongings? The ScotRail customer service is just an email away, ready to ensure your journey is smooth from start to finish.
Walking between the platforms is made easy with a footbridge and step-free access to certain areas, thereby accommodating travelers with mobility challenges. While accessible toilets and lounges are currently absent, the availability of basic facilities, including sheltered bicycle storage and a seating area, ensure that you wait in comfort for your train.
Public transportation is well catered for at Wishaw, linking it seamlessly with the rest of the locality. For additional travel flexibility, buses operate from nearby Belhaven Road, and taxis are easily arranged through TrainTaxi. For detailed local bus services, you might consider visiting Traveline Scotland or contacting their 24-hour hotline at 0871 200 22 33, ensuring you're connected around the clock.
